    Got it working to, with this and some improvisation.
    All buttons work including the stamina/speed switch

    Sony eSupport - VPCSB1AGX - Software Updates & Drivers

    I used this installation order(don't know if it will help someone else but it worked for me):
    - Sony shared library
    - SFEP Driver
    - Setting Utility Series
    - Vaio Event Service
    -radeon registery patch from the support page
    -Intel GMA HD drivers from the intel site
    -AMD Radeon™ HD 6470M / 6630M and Mobile Intel® HD Graphics

    Some of the drivers might be to much, but it works like a charm with no errors :)

    Ok, lets begin:

    The AMD 6630m, is already a lowe clocked version of the 6600/6700 series, being it composed of the 6650 and the 6730, all those models carry GDDR3, the 6750 and 6770 carry GDDR5, the clocks and the memory are the variations.

    The 4670m that I have, can play games fluently at 30+fps on high settings, according to the benches already posted in this thread there is an improvement for me around 15-30% depending on the games, so, yes it will retain the capability to play games at the lower res that is available.

    Now I wouldnt trust completely on notebookcheck, they have a bias for nvidia. Aside that the methodology is not the best that we can call it standard, not even good, just standard.

    Another thing is that 3dmark06 is of little value these days, being it more CPU dependent than gpu, vantage and 3dmark11 are more reliable, not that they serve for anything aside from bragging rights

    On a side note the only usual thing that they get right is the specs of the cards, that is one thing that is reliable

    For part one, I have always known Crucial and Kingston to be the best reliability for laptop RAM. I have a lot of gamer friends that swear by OCZ and Corsair though too for desktop RAM anyway. FYI, I bought a Crucial stick from newegg. http://www.newegg.com/Product/Product.aspx?Item=N82E16820148344&cm_re=crucial_4gb_ddr3_1333-_-20-148-344-_-Product

    Part 2, most likely depends on the stick. Most companies make varying speed and latencies per part number. Like you can buy a DDR3-1333 in CAS latency 7, 8, or 9. Price just gets more expensive as you go down and voltage tends to go up to run those tight times. This more or less applies to desktops in a greater deal as laptop RAM is less common. Also, higher speed of DDR3 usually has looser(higher) timings sometimes in excess of CAS 9. Gamers usually want low CAS as a priorty.
